Negotiated property purchase

Negotiated property purchase – this term within the area of Real Estate Law, usually refers to a real estate deal, where all the initially offered terms and conditions of the purchase have later been successfully negotiated between the two parties or between their lawyers, in order to reach a property transfer in the form of a Title Deed (in most jurisdictions).
